What is the Horizons Summer Program?
Horizons Summer Program, based at New Canaan Country School, serves close to 300 children in grades K-9 living primarily in Stamford and Norwalk. This six-week Summer Program provides academic classes in reading, writing and math, as well as a wide range of creative and fun enrichment activities like swimming, art, music and field trips. Each class has ten to twelve students, one Lead Teacher and one Teaching Assistant.

Can I still work with Horizons if I can't work full time or the full six weeks?
Teaching Assistants must commit to the full six weeks of our program which runs daily from 8 : 00 a.m. to 3 : 00 p.m. Because we only have 28 days with our children, we need the staff to be a consistent presence in the full program.
What is the role of the Teaching Assistant?
Teaching Assistants support the Lead Teacher in providing educational enrichment activities to a group of ten to twelve children. TAs shepherd students to special programs and classes, assist with snack and lunch set up and supervise field trips, etc. TAs are active participants in the afternoon swim program, helping students, in the pool, with instructional and recreational activities.

Do I qualify for the TA position if I am not yet sixteen years old?
In order to get a full-time, paid position at Horizons, you need to be at least sixteen, and at least a junior in High School.
